Artwork

Artwork by Cedric Price, predominantly early work from childhood and university, with a small number of later items and designs for promotional material. Chiefly loose items, many of which were originally bundled into a large portfolio; plus a drawing book. [Note: CP's notebooks may be found at Price 1/8.]

Price showed himself to be an excellent draughtsman from an early age. The work is in a variety of styles: graphic designs, line drawings (including technical), diagrams, doodles and sketches, rough and fine work. Some are abstract subjects, most are concrete; many concern buildings (mostly domestic) observed or imagined, boats and marinas, landscapes and seascapes.

Media includes pencil, coloured pencil, draughting pen, watercolours, biro, prints. Also includes some photocopies (colour and black-and-white) of originals.

Artefacts

Mixture of Cedric Price's personal and professional effects, including clothing, pin badges, toys, cigar boxes, posters and prints, ephemera, collected postcards, and some of his iconic detachable collars.
